A major redevelopment project in Milan, Italy is using six Manitowoc Potain tower cranes.

The Porta Nuova project will renovate three existing neighborhoods on the outskirts of the Italian city. Spread over 290,000 square metres, it includes a series of skyscrapers, piazzas, parks and bridges which will reconnect the districts of Garibaldi, Varesine and Isola.
